Shortly before moving away from Portland, I got the chance to have a farewell lunch with Professor Hyong Rhew, one of just three or four people whom I call "my most beloved teachers." Also present was my long-time friend Chris Stasse, whom I similarly call one of "my most beloved friends."
This poem commemorates the mischievous post-prandial activities of that day. I believe this is the first poem I've written for Chris; it probably won't be the last.
最后一杯 干了之后 老师告别 哥俩要走 笑着回家 大麻便抽 疯狂假想 做双朋友
A loose translation, 2019-12-20, 11:41:01-0800:
One last cup Drained The teacher bids goodbye The two boys Leave Laughing all the way home "Big Hemp" is Smoked Wild fancies take flight Such is a pair of friends!
